Note the four horizontal louvres on the side panel of the car (below) Work on the car seemed not to have been fully finalised when the ‘dazzleship’ shakedown pictures were taken of the Cadillac DPi-V.R. The headlamps have been restyled again for brand identity reasons and the leading edges of the front wheelpods appear to have been reshaped with the leading edge of the bodywork on the DPi version (Above) slightly more pronounced compared to the LMP2 version (below)

The ducting in the nose is reshaped for brand identity/styling reasons but serves the same brake cooling role. In some areas the bodywork is far more angular, partly for styling reasons and partly for aerodynamic performance.Ī clearer look could be had when the Action Express and Wayne Taylor Racing teams ran thier new cars in testing at Daytona. This version of the design made its track debut in private testing in late 2016.ĭespite the dazzle ship wrap on the car it is possible to discern some of the differences between the Gibson V8 powered P217. The social media account of Racing Team Netherlands has given a good overview of the Dallara LMP2 design including this look inside the cockpit (below) all 2017 specifcation LMP2 cars use identical electronic equipment supplied by Cosworth, the only realy variance is how the various components are mounted.ĭallara collaborated with General Motors throughout the development to create a Daytona Prototype International (DPi) specification variant of the car. Rear brake cooling is via ducts on the leading edge of the rear wheel pods (below) The front suspension features pushrod actuated torsion bars mounted in the front bulkhead (below).

The car features a raised nose in common with a number of other LMP designs including the ORECA 05, though it is not as extreme as that used on the rival Ligier JS P217.įront brake cooling is via oval slots on the leading edge of the front bodywork these feed ducts mounted inside the nose of the car leading to the disc and uprights. The overall design of the P217 appears fairly conventional as is expected from Dallara, which had a reputation for making conventional, but well executed and fast racecars.Ī better look at the P217 came when the Racing Team Netherlands car took part in a number of test sessions including a Dunlop tyre test at Sebring. Pictures of it testing in Italy had already leaked in the print media. At a motor show in Bologna a P217 was briefly shown off with very little fanfare. The official reveal of the car did not come until late 2016 and then with very little fanfare indeed. In the background of this picture of senior Dallara Manager Andrea Pontremoli the early wind tunnel model of the P217 is seen in the working section of Dallara’s own wind tunnel. The first sighting of the new design came unexpectedly via a press release on a completely unrelated project. However with that partnership coming to an amicable end (another Italian firm, YCOM, was responsible for the final generation Audi R18s) Dallara set out to develop an all new design for the new LMP2 technical regulations. Its last LMP was of course the early generation Audi R18, and its deal with the German marque meant that it could not build Le Mans cars under its own brand during the whole R8-R10-R15 programme.

The Dallara P217 is the first Le Mans Prototype for a few years to be built by the famous Italian constructor.
